The Google Nexus 9 is a lot better than the Amazon Fire HD 8, getting a 74.5 score against 54.1. Both of these tablets include Android OS, but the Google Nexus 9 has the previous 5.0 version and Amazon Fire HD 8 has Android 5.0 Lollipop version. The Google Nexus 9 is an older, heavier and just a little thicker device than Amazon Fire HD 8.
Google Nexus 9 counts with an incredibly better looking screen than Amazon Fire HD 8, because it has a lot higher resolution of 2048 x 1536, a little bit larger display and way more pixels per inch in the screen. Google Nexus 9 features a better performing CPU than Amazon Fire HD 8, because although it has a lower number of cores , it also counts with more RAM memory and a 64 bits processor.
Amazon Fire HD 8 has a quite bigger storage capacity for apps and games than Google Nexus 9, because although it has 0 less internal memory capacity, it also counts with a slot for an SD memory card that allows a maximum of 128 GB. The Google Nexus 9 counts with a very superior battery performance than Amazon Fire HD 8.
The Google Nexus 9 captures a lot better videos and photos than Amazon Fire HD 8, and although they both have the same video resolution and the same video frame rates, the Google Nexus 9 also has a way more mega pixels camera.
Google Nexus 9 costs a lot more money than the Amazon Fire HD 8, but it's still a convenient choice, because you can get a lot more features for that extra money.
